Understanding the Importance of CR Renewal

 

The Commercial Registration is the official record that legally recognizes your business in Saudi Arabia. It contains essential details such as the business name, activities, ownership structure, and registration number. Without a valid CR, a business cannot legally operate.

Renewing your CR on time ensures:

  • Continued legal operation of your business
  • Ability to conduct financial transactions and banking activities
  • Renewal of related licenses and permits
  • Avoidance of fines and penalties
  • Protection of your company’s reputation

Delays in renewal can create a ripple effect across multiple business functions, including contracts, visas, and financial compliance.

When to Renew Your CR License

 

CR licenses in Saudi Arabia are issued for a specific validity period, typically ranging from one to five years depending on the registration type. It is crucial to track the expiration date carefully.

Businesses should aim to begin the renewal process:

  • At least 30 to 60 days before the expiration date
  • Earlier if additional approvals or documentation are required
  • Immediately if the CR is close to expiration to avoid penalties

Proactive planning is key. Waiting until the last minute increases the risk of delays due to system issues, missing documents, or unexpected compliance requirements.


Key Requirements for CR Renewal

 

Before initiating the renewal process, ensure that your business meets all necessary requirements. These may include:

  • Valid national address registration
  • Active membership with the Chamber of Commerce
  • Updated company information in government systems
  • No outstanding fines or violations
  • Valid licenses related to your business activity
  • Compliance with Saudization (Nitaqat) requirements if applicable

Failure to meet any of these conditions may prevent successful renewal.


Preparing Documents in Advance

 

A smooth CR renewal process depends on proper documentation. While the process is largely digital, having your information organized helps avoid delays.

Common documents and details required include:

  • Commercial Registration number
  • Company details and ownership information
  • National ID or Iqama of the owner or authorized manager
  • Contact information such as phone number and email
  • Details of business activities
  • Payment method for renewal fees

Keeping digital copies ready ensures a faster and hassle-free process.


Step-by-Step Process to Renew CR License

 

Renewing a CR license in Saudi Arabia is primarily done online through the official business portal. The process is straightforward if all requirements are met.

Start by logging into the official portal using your credentials. Navigate to the Commercial Registration section and select the renewal option. Enter your CR number and verify the displayed details carefully.

Choose the renewal period based on your business needs. Longer renewal periods can reduce administrative workload but require higher upfront fees.

Review all information before submission. Once confirmed, proceed to generate the payment invoice. After completing the payment, your CR will be renewed, and you can download the updated certificate digitally.


Payment of Renewal Fees

 

CR renewal involves certain fees that vary depending on the type of business and duration of renewal. Payments are typically made through electronic channels such as:

  • Online banking systems
  • SADAD payment system
  • Mobile banking applications

Ensure that payment is completed promptly after generating the invoice, as delays can cause the application to expire.

Role of the Chamber of Commerce

 

The Chamber of Commerce membership must be active for CR renewal. In most cases, renewing your CR automatically updates your Chamber membership, but it is important to verify this.

If your Chamber membership has expired, you may need to renew it separately before completing the CR renewal process.


Avoiding Common Mistakes

 

Many businesses face delays or penalties due to avoidable mistakes. Being aware of these issues can help ensure a smooth renewal process.

One common mistake is ignoring the renewal deadline until it is too late. Businesses often assume they will have enough time, only to encounter unexpected issues.

Another issue is incomplete or outdated business information. Any discrepancies in company details can lead to rejection or delays.

Failure to clear fines or violations is another common obstacle. Government systems may block renewal if there are outstanding issues.

Not maintaining an active national address or Chamber membership can also prevent successful renewal.

Consequences of Missing the Deadline

 

Failing to renew your CR license on time can have serious consequences.

Businesses may face financial penalties that increase over time. Continued non-renewal can lead to suspension of business activities or cancellation of the CR.

It can also impact your ability to:

  • Renew visas and work permits
  • Open or maintain bank accounts
  • Sign contracts or agreements
  • Participate in tenders or government projects

In severe cases, prolonged non-compliance may lead to legal action.


Handling Expired CR Licenses

 

If your CR has already expired, it is important to act immediately.

The renewal process may still be available within a certain grace period, but penalties will apply. The longer you wait, the higher the fines and the more complicated the process becomes.

In some cases, additional approvals or documentation may be required to reactivate the CR.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renewing CR Licenses Before Deadline in KSA

What is a Commercial Registration (CR) license in Saudi Arabia

A Commercial Registration license is the official document that legally allows a business to operate in Saudi Arabia. It records essential details such as the company name, activities, ownership structure, and registration number. Without a valid CR, a business cannot carry out legal commercial activities in the Kingdom.

How can I check the expiration date of my CR license

You can check the expiration date of your CR license through the official online business portal by logging into your account and viewing your company details. The expiration date is also usually mentioned on the CR certificate itself. It is important to monitor this date regularly to avoid missing the renewal deadline.

When should I start the CR renewal process

It is recommended to begin the renewal process at least 30 to 60 days before the expiration date. Starting early gives you enough time to resolve any issues such as unpaid fines, expired memberships, or missing information.

Can I renew my CR license after it expires

Yes, you can renew your CR license after it expires, but this may involve penalties. The longer the delay, the higher the fines and the greater the risk of business disruptions. Immediate action is advised if your CR has already expired.

What happens if I do not renew my CR on time

Failure to renew your CR on time can result in financial penalties, suspension of business activities, and possible cancellation of the registration. It can also impact your ability to conduct banking transactions, renew visas, and sign legal agreements.

Is it possible to renew the CR license online

Yes, the CR renewal process in Saudi Arabia is fully digital. Businesses can complete the entire process online through the official portal, including submitting details, selecting the renewal period, and making payments.

What are the main requirements for renewing a CR license

To renew a CR license, your business must have an active national address, valid Chamber of Commerce membership, up-to-date company information, and no outstanding fines or violations. Some businesses may also need to meet Saudization requirements depending on their activity.

Do I need to renew the Chamber of Commerce membership separately

In many cases, the Chamber of Commerce membership is renewed automatically during the CR renewal process. However, if it has already expired, you may need to renew it separately before completing the CR renewal.

How much does it cost to renew a CR license

The cost of renewing a CR license depends on the type of business and the duration of renewal. Fees are typically calculated on a yearly basis. Additional charges may apply for Chamber of Commerce membership and other related services.

What payment methods are available for CR renewal

Payments can be made through various electronic channels, including online banking, mobile banking apps, and the SADAD payment system. It is important to complete the payment promptly after generating the invoice.

Can I choose the duration for CR renewal

Yes, businesses can choose the renewal period, usually ranging from one to five years. Selecting a longer duration can reduce the frequency of renewals but requires a higher upfront payment.

What documents are required for CR renewal

The process is mostly digital, so physical documents are rarely needed. However, you should have your CR number, company details, identification documents, and updated contact information ready for verification.

What should I do if my CR renewal application is rejected

If your application is rejected, carefully review the reason provided. Common issues include incorrect information, expired memberships, or unpaid fines. Correct the problem and resubmit the application as soon as possible.

Are there penalties for late renewal of CR licenses

Yes, penalties are imposed for late renewal. The amount increases depending on how long the CR has been expired. Additional consequences may include restrictions on business operations.

Can foreign investors renew CR licenses themselves

Foreign investors can renew CR licenses if they have access to the official portal and meet all requirements. However, many prefer to use business consultants or authorized representatives to handle the process efficiently.

How long does it take to renew a CR license

If all requirements are met and there are no issues, the renewal process can be completed within a few hours. Delays may occur if there are compliance issues or system-related problems.

What is the role of the national address in CR renewal

The national address is a mandatory requirement for businesses in Saudi Arabia. It must be active and updated, as it is linked to your company’s official records and is required for completing the renewal process.

Can I update my business information during renewal

Yes, you can update certain business details during the renewal process. However, major changes such as ownership structure or business activity may require additional approvals.

Is CR renewal linked to other business licenses

Yes, CR renewal is often connected to other licenses and permits. If your CR expires, it may affect your ability to renew municipal licenses, visas, and other regulatory approvals.

What should I do to avoid missing the CR renewal deadline

To avoid missing the deadline, set up multiple reminders using calendars or digital tools. Regularly monitor your CR status and ensure all related requirements are up to date. Assign responsibility to a specific team member or consider using professional services for compliance management.

Can I cancel my CR instead of renewing it

Yes, if you no longer wish to operate your business, you can cancel your CR instead of renewing it. This process involves clearing all liabilities, closing accounts, and completing official cancellation procedures.

Is it mandatory to have no fines before renewing the CR

Yes, all outstanding fines and violations must typically be cleared before you can successfully renew your CR license. Government systems may block the renewal until all dues are settled.

How can business consultants help with CR renewal

Business consultants can manage the entire renewal process on your behalf. They ensure compliance, handle documentation, track deadlines, and resolve issues quickly, saving you time and reducing the risk of errors.

Does early renewal provide any advantages

Yes, early renewal helps avoid last-minute stress, ensures uninterrupted operations, and allows time to fix any unexpected issues. It also demonstrates strong compliance practices.

What are the risks of operating with an expired CR

Operating with an expired CR is illegal and can lead to serious consequences, including fines, suspension of activities, and legal action. It can also damage your business reputation and relationships with clients and partners.
